Discovering Udaipur’s Majestic Palaces and Scenic Lakes

Royal Romance of Udaipur: Palaces, Lakes & Hidden Gems Tour - Discovering Udaipur’s Majestic Palaces and Scenic Lakes

City Palace is undoubtedly the highlight of this tour. It’s not just grand in size but also in detail. The guide will walk you through its corridors, pointing out intricate carvings and explaining the stories of the Mewar rulers. It’s a chance to feel like royalty for a few hours. Travelers often appreciate the chance to explore at a relaxed pace, soaking in the architecture and history without feeling rushed.

The boat ride on Lake Pichola is another must-do. Gliding across these tranquil waters, you’ll get spectacular views of Lake Palace and Jag Mandir, which appear to float like jewels. Reviewers love this part for the photos and the peaceful atmosphere. One review mentions, “The boat ride was a highlight; the views of the palace shimmering at sunset are unforgettable.” It’s a perfect way to see Udaipur from a different perspective.

Sunset Views and Cultural Delights

Royal Romance of Udaipur: Palaces, Lakes & Hidden Gems Tour - Sunset Views and Cultural Delights

One of the most cherished moments is watching the sunset over Fateh Sagar Lake or Sajjangarh Palace. The viewpoints offer sweeping vistas of the city, lakes, and distant hills. The sunset is often described as breathtaking, providing perfect photo opportunities and a moment of tranquility.

The tour also includes stops at local markets and art hubs, where you can browse through Rajasthani textiles, jewelry, and crafts. These markets are lively and colorful, giving travelers a taste of the local artistic spirit. Guides often share stories behind the crafts, enriching the shopping experience.
